NAJBLIŻSZY KURS STARTUJE 08.06.2026

PROGRAMISTA ORACLE

Kompleksowy pakiet szkoleń od SQL, przez PL/SQL i tuning wydajności, aż po tworzenie aplikacji w Oracle APEX

18
dni szkoleniowych
4
szkolenia w pakiecie
25%
oszczędzasz w pakiecie
ORACLE SQL PLSQL DDL DML APEX ETL

Programista Oracle

Nasz pakiet szkoleń to kompleksowa ścieżka rozwoju w ekosystemie Oracle — od podstaw SQL, przez zaawansowane programowanie PL/SQL i optymalizację zapytań, aż po tworzenie aplikacji w Oracle APEX.

Od SQL po Oracle APEX

Cztery poziomy zaawansowania przeprowadzą Cię od fundamentów SQL, przez profesjonalne programowanie PL/SQL, optymalizację wydajności zapytań, aż po tworzenie aplikacji low-code w Oracle APEX.

Elastyczne terminy w ciągu roku

Szkolenia możesz rozłożyć w czasie według własnych upodobań na przestrzeni roku w ramach dostępnych terminów. Sam decydujesz o tempie nauki, dopasowując je do swoich obowiązków zawodowych. Terminy oznaczone jako gwarantowane odbędą się na 100% — nawet jeśli miałbyś być jedyną osobą na szkoleniu.

Oszczędność 25% w pakiecie

Kupując wszystkie 4 szkolenia w pakiecie oszczędzasz 3 225 zł netto (3 966 zł brutto). To najlepsza inwestycja w kompetencje Oracle Development dla siebie lub swojego zespołu.

Trenerzy-praktycy z oceną min. 4.75/5

Nie ma wśród nas trenerów-teoretyków. Każdy trener JSystems ma bogate doświadczenie komercyjne w technologiach, których uczy, i musi utrzymywać średnią z ankiet uczestników powyżej 4.75 na 5. Czerwony pasek to u nas minimum ;)

poznaj trenerów

Format warsztatowy

Warsztatowy format zapewnia dobre utrwalenie wiedzy i co najważniejsze — dobre zrozumienie przerabianych zagadnień. Każde zagadnienie teoretyczne jest poparte praktycznymi ćwiczeniami o rosnącym poziomie trudności, dzięki czemu zdobyte umiejętności możesz od razu zastosować w pracy.

Gotowe środowiska w chmurze

Do każdego szkolenia wymagającego oprogramowania dostarczamy skonfigurowane, gotowe hosty w chmurze. Uczestnik nie musi nic instalować — łączy się przez zdalny pulpit lub SSH.

4 etapy do zostania Programistą Oracle

1

ETAP I — Kompleksowe szkolenie SQL w Oracle

5 dni
Podstawowy

Pierwszym szkoleniem jest «Kompleksowe szkolenie SQL w Oracle». Obejmuje ono swoim zakresem fundamenty SQL niezbędne do pracy z bazami danych Oracle — od podstawowych zapytań po funkcje analityczne i wyrażenia regularne.

01
Wstęp do baz danych Oracle
  • Architektura Oracle, instancja, baza danych, schematy
02
SQL*Plus i SQL Developer
  • Narzędzia pracy z bazą Oracle, konfiguracja połączenia
03
Podstawowe zapytania SELECT
  • SELECT, FROM, aliasy, wyrażenia, literały
04
Sortowanie i filtrowanie danych
  • WHERE, ORDER BY, operatory porównania, BETWEEN, IN, LIKE
05
Funkcje wbudowane
  • Funkcje znakowe, numeryczne, daty, NVL, DECODE, CASE
06
Konwersja danych
  • TO_CHAR, TO_NUMBER, TO_DATE, konwersja niejawna
07
Agregacja danych
  • GROUP BY, HAVING, COUNT, SUM, AVG, MIN, MAX
08
Zapytania wielotabelowe
  • JOIN, INNER JOIN, LEFT/RIGHT/FULL OUTER JOIN, CROSS JOIN
09
Podzapytania
  • Podzapytania skorelowane i nieskorelowane, EXISTS, IN
10
Operatory zbiorowe
  • UNION, UNION ALL, INTERSECT, MINUS
11
Instrukcje DML i DDL
  • INSERT, UPDATE, DELETE, MERGE, CREATE, ALTER, DROP
12
Zapytania hierarchiczne
  • CONNECT BY, START WITH, LEVEL, SYS_CONNECT_BY_PATH
13
Funkcje analityczne
  • ROW_NUMBER, RANK, DENSE_RANK, LAG, LEAD, OVER(PARTITION BY)
14
Wyrażenia regularne
  • REGEXP_LIKE, REGEXP_SUBSTR, REGEXP_REPLACE, REGEXP_INSTR
15
Transakcje i Flashback
  • COMMIT, ROLLBACK, SAVEPOINT, Flashback Query
Szczegóły i terminy szkolenia
2

ETAP II — Kompleksowe szkolenie programowanie w PL/SQL w Oracle

5 dni
Średniozaawansowany

Szkolenie «Kompleksowe szkolenie PL/SQL» to pogłębienie wiedzy o programowaniu proceduralnym w Oracle. Omówimy bloki anonimowe, kursory, wyjątki, pakiety, wyzwalacze, dynamiczny SQL i operacje masowe.

01
Wprowadzenie do PL/SQL
  • Architektura PL/SQL, środowisko wykonawcze, struktura bloków
02
Bloki anonimowe
  • DECLARE, BEGIN, EXCEPTION, END, zmienne, stałe, typy danych
03
Instrukcje sterujące
  • IF/ELSIF/ELSE, CASE, LOOP, WHILE, FOR, EXIT, CONTINUE
04
Złożone typy danych
  • %TYPE, %ROWTYPE, rekordy, kolekcje, tablice asocjacyjne
05
Kursory
  • Kursory jawne i niejawne, parametryzowane, FOR loop, REF CURSOR
06
Wyjątki
  • Wyjątki predefiniowane, użytkownika, RAISE, RAISE_APPLICATION_ERROR
07
Procedury i funkcje
  • CREATE PROCEDURE/FUNCTION, parametry IN/OUT/IN OUT, RETURN
08
Pakiety
  • Specyfikacja i ciało pakietu, zmienne pakietowe, inicjalizacja
09
Wyzwalacze (triggery)
  • BEFORE/AFTER, FOR EACH ROW, INSTEAD OF, compound triggers
10
Dynamiczny SQL
  • EXECUTE IMMEDIATE, DBMS_SQL, dynamiczne kursory
11
Operacje masowe
  • BULK COLLECT, FORALL, LIMIT, wydajność operacji masowych
12
Operacje na plikach (UTL_FILE)
  • Odczyt i zapis plików, katalogi, obsługa błędów I/O
13
Harmonogramowanie zadań (DBMS_SCHEDULER)
  • Tworzenie jobów, harmonogramy, łańcuchy zadań, monitorowanie
14
SQL Loader i tabele zewnętrzne
  • Ładowanie danych z plików, control file, external tables
15
Optymalizacja pamięci i dobre praktyki
  • PGA, UGA, zarządzanie pamięcią, coding standards, debugging
Szczegóły i terminy szkolenia
3

ETAP III — Szkolenie kompleksowe: Tuning wydajności SQL w bazach danych Oracle 12c - 21c

5 dni
Zaawansowany

Szkolenie «Tuning wydajności SQL» to praktyczny kurs optymalizacji zapytań w Oracle. Omówimy architekturę bazy danych, metody dostępu do danych, indeksy, optymalizator kosztowy i narzędzia diagnostyczne.

01
Wprowadzenie do tuningu
  • Cele tuningu, metodologia, identyfikacja wąskich gardeł
02
Architektura bazy danych Oracle
  • SGA, PGA, procesy tła, instancja vs baza danych
03
Struktura fizyczna i logiczna
  • Tablespace, segmenty, ekstenty, bloki danych
04
Metody dostępu do danych
  • Full Table Scan, Index Scan, Hash Join, Nested Loops, Sort Merge
05
Indeksy B-Tree i bitmapowe
  • Struktura indeksów, selektywność, kiedy stosować jaki typ
06
Indeksy funkcyjne
  • Indeksy na wyrażeniach, indeksy odwrócone, invisible indexes
07
Optymalizator kosztowy (CBO)
  • Działanie CBO, hinty, transformacje zapytań, plany wykonania
08
Statystyki tabel i indeksów
  • DBMS_STATS, zbieranie statystyk, statystyki rozszerzone
09
Histogramy
  • Typy histogramów, skośność danych, wpływ na plany wykonania
10
Explain Plan i Autotrace
  • Analiza planów wykonania, DBMS_XPLAN, interpretacja wyników
11
SQL Trace i TKPROF
  • Śledzenie zapytań, analiza plików trace, identyfikacja problemów
12
Zmienne bindowane i współdzielone kursory
  • Bind variables, cursor sharing, adaptive cursor sharing
Szczegóły i terminy szkolenia
4

ETAP IV — Programowanie w Oracle Apex

3 dni
Zaawansowany

Szkolenie «Oracle APEX» to praktyczny kurs tworzenia aplikacji low-code w ekosystemie Oracle. Omówimy raporty, wykresy, formularze, procesy, walidacje, bezpieczeństwo i integrację z usługami zewnętrznymi.

01
Architektura i zasady działania
  • Architektura APEX, ORDS, workspace, aplikacje, strony
02
Aplikacje oparte o bazy danych
  • Tworzenie aplikacji, źródła danych, wizardy, szablony
03
Raporty klasyczne i interaktywne
  • Classic Reports, Interactive Reports, Interactive Grids, filtrowanie
04
Wykresy klasyczne i interaktywne
  • Oracle JET Charts, typy wykresów, konfiguracja, dane dynamiczne
05
Formularze
  • Formularze tabelowe, master-detail, walidacja danych wejściowych
06
Strony, regiony i elementy
  • Page Designer, typy regionów, elementy strony, Dynamic Actions
07
Procesy i walidacje
  • Page Processes, Validations, Computations, Branches
08
Motywy i szablony
  • Universal Theme, szablony stron i regionów, CSS customization
09
Nawigacja i bezpieczeństwo
  • Menu, breadcrumbs, autoryzacja, schematy uwierzytelniania
10
Kalendarze i mapy
  • Calendar region, Map region, geolokalizacja, konfiguracja
11
Wtyczki i narzędzia deweloperskie
  • Plug-ins, APEX Debug, App Builder utilities, eksport/import
12
Integracja z usługami zewnętrznymi
  • REST Data Sources, Web Source Modules, APEX_WEB_SERVICE
Szczegóły i terminy szkolenia

Jak wygląda szkolenie?

Online przez Zoom

Szkolenie na żywo z trenerem. Nie jest to kurs wideo — aktywna interakcja, ćwiczenia i możliwość zadawania pytań w czasie rzeczywistym. Grupy ze względu na efektywność szkolenia liczą maksymalnie kilkanaście osób.

Gotowe środowiska w chmurze

Do każdego szkolenia wymagającego oprogramowania dostarczamy skonfigurowane, gotowe hosty w chmurze. Uczestnik nie musi nic instalować — łączy się przez zdalny pulpit lub SSH.

Certyfikat ukończenia

Po ukończeniu każdego szkolenia z pakietu otrzymujesz imienny certyfikat potwierdzający zdobyte kompetencje

Zainwestuj w swoją przyszłość

Kompletny pakiet szkoleń Oracle w najlepszej cenie

PAKIET 4 SZKOLEŃ — OSZCZĘDZASZ 25%

Programista Oracle

18 dni szkoleniowych • 4 szkolenia • od SQL po Oracle APEX

12 900 złnetto 9 675 zł netto
(11 900 zł brutto)
lub
12 x 1 111 zł brutto/mies.

Operatorem płatności ratalnej jest Bank Pekao S.A. Rzeczywista Roczna Stopa Oprocentowania (RRSO) wynosi 23,56%. Całkowita kwota kredytu (bez kredytowanych kosztów): 11 900 zł. Całkowita kwota do zapłaty: 13 328 zł. Oprocentowanie stałe: 0% w skali roku. Całkowity koszt kredytu: 1 428 zł (w tym: prowizja 1 428 zł, odsetki 0 zł). Umowa zawarta na okres 12 miesięcy, spłata w 12 miesięcznych ratach po 1 111 zł. Kalkulacja została dokonana na dzień 17.03.2025 na reprezentatywnym przykładzie. Finansowanie zapewnia zewnętrzny operator płatności ratalnych. Przyznanie kredytu zależy od oceny zdolności kredytowej klienta.

Oszczędzasz 3 225 zł netto / 3 966 zł brutto
Możliwość dofinansowania z BUR / KFS
Materiały szkoleniowe
4 certyfikaty ukończenia
Gotowe środowiska w chmurze
Elastyczne terminy przez cały rok

Możliwość dofinansowania

Istnieje możliwość sfinansowania całości lub części kursu z BUR lub KFS. Skontaktuj się z nami — pomożemy przejść przez formalności.

Dowiedz się więcej o dofinansowaniach

A może nielimitowany rozwój?

Dopłać niewiele więcej i uzyskaj Karnet OPEN — dostęp do dowolnej ilości gwarantowanych terminów szkoleń z całego naszego katalogu przez cały rok.

Dopłata jednorazowo 399 zł brutto
Dopłata w 12 ratach 37 zł brutto/mies.
Poznaj Karnet OPEN

Praktycy, nie teoretycy

Poznaj ekspertów prowadzących szkolenia w pakiecie Oracle

Każdy trener JSystems ma bogate doświadczenie komercyjne w technologiach, których uczy, i musi utrzymywać średnią z ankiet uczestników powyżej 4.75 na 5. Czerwony pasek to u nas minimum ;)

Monika Lewandowska

Monika Lewandowska

Monika jest doświadczoną projektantką i programistką baz danych Oracle. Swoją przygodę z Oracle zaczęła jeszcze w zeszłym stuleciu od Oracle 7, i kontynuuje ją po dziś dzień. Monika należy do programu Oracle ACE (ACE Pro) oraz do organizacji Symposium 42. Lubi dzielić się wiedzą i bierze udział jako prelegent w międzynarodowych konferencjach poświęconych tematyce Oracle (POUG, DOAG, UKOUG, RMOUG i wiele innych). Podczas tworzenie oprogramowania największy nacisk kładzie na zrozumienie wymagań klienta, prostotę rozwiązań oraz jakość kodu. A ponad wszystko – na wydajność systemu! Kocha szybkie motocykle i jeszcze szybsze bazy danych!

pokaż więcej
Michał Bieniek

Michał Bieniek

Programista baz danych od 2012 roku. Specjalizuje się w wytwarzaniu oprogramowania w językach PL/SQL i PL/pgSQL, T-SQL oraz technologii Oracle Forms and Reports dla administracji publicznej, branży telekomunikacyjnej, sektora bankowego oraz agencji marketingowych. W latach 2019-2020 zdał egzaminy certyfikacyjne Oracle Database SQL Certified Associate i Oracle PL/SQL Developer Certified Associate. Cały czas poznaje nowe zagadnienia i szuka nowych wyzwań.

pokaż więcej
Przemysław Starosta

Przemysław Starosta

Absolwent Uniwersytetu im. Adama Mickiewicza, Politechniki Poznańskiej i Wyższej Szkoły Bankowej. Właściciel firmy informatycznej, kierownik projektów, programista baz danych i wykładowca na Collegium da Vinci w Poznaniu. Specjalista z zakresu baz danych Oracle, SQL Server i PostgreSQL oraz procesów ETL. Programista C#. Pasjonat edukacji i analizy danych oraz możliwości biznesowych, które one odkrywają. Trener z ponad 10-letnim doświadczeniem. Na szkoleniach praktykuje zasadę: learning by doing – uczenie przez robienie. Prelegent SQL Day oraz Warszawskich Dni Informatyki. Prywatnie fan FC Barcelony oraz mieszanych sztuk walki.

pokaż więcej

Co mówią nasi kursanci

*Dane na podstawie ankiet uczestników

JSystems — szkolenia IT klasy PREMIUM

Pod marką JSystems istniejemy od 2008 roku od początku oferując szkolenia z zakresu baz danych, programowania i systemów operacyjnych. Zrzeszamy specjalistów o bogatym doświadczeniu zawodowym, pasjonatów swoich technologii. Naszym priorytetem jest zadowolenie klienta, więc bezustannie poprawiamy jakość naszych usług. Stawiamy na praktykę dlatego nasze szkolenia mają formę warsztatową. Większość czasu na szkoleniach uczestnik spędza na praktycznym wykorzystaniu uzyskanej wiedzy.

Pakiet szkoleń

Zamów pakiet
w atrakcyjnej cenie

Zostaw dane — oddzwonimy lub odpiszemy w ciągu jednego dnia roboczego. Bez zobowiązań.

Rabat 25% Oszczędzasz 3 225 zł netto
Płatność ratalna Wygodne 12 rat miesięcznych
4 szkolenia w pakiecie 18 dni warsztatów na żywo

Masz pytania? Skontaktuj się z nami

Zamów pakiet

Wybierz formę płatności

Podaj telefon lub e-mail — potrzebujemy co najmniej jednego, aby się z Tobą skontaktować.

Proszę wybrać formę płatności.
Proszę podać numer telefonu lub adres e-mail.
Programista Oracle 4 szkolenia • 18 dni
12 900 zł 9 675 zł netto
oszczędzasz 3 225 zł netto rata 1 111 zł brutto/mies. Zapisz się

A może nielimitowane szkolenia za
1 148 PLN brutto / mies.?
Sprawdź Karnet Open
Karnet Open za 1 148 PLN brutto/mies.